Synopsis "Dong Gap Tay - Tap 1 (Black & White) (in Vietnamita)"

"EAST meets WEST is a detailed historical account which covers an amazing 85-year period by an exceptional first-hand witness. It is not only a poignant story of War and Peace but much more interesting are the descriptions of clashes between culture, the merging between different traditions and customs, the evolution in ways of life and family values, and finally the successful integration into the American Melting Pot. Another remarkable aspect of this book is its illustrations with hundreds of photographs and documents depicting people, events, places and the flow of time. It is a valuable reference book as well as outstanding and entertaining reading." "EAST meets WEST" was written by DIEU KHUONG-HUU. The author was recognized by THE NEW YORK TIMES in an article published on Sunday, June 3, 1956 with a title as "Vietnam student here wins M.I.T. Fellowship" "A Vietnamese student at Lafayette College has won a fellowship at Massachusetts Institute Technology, the college said this week. He is Dieu Khuong-Huu, a senior. He ranks first in his field of study, although he has had to work his way through college. He will receive a Bachelor of Science degree in Mechanical Engineering at Lafayette's commencement Thursday. He won one of the five Tau Beta Pi Association fellowships. This will enable him to study at M.I.T. for a master's degree in Mechanical Engineering. After that he plans to return to Vietnam to work there."
